Psychotherapy, usually called "talk treatment" or "treatment" for brief, is a treatment that includes chatting with a qualified mental health care professional to assist identify as well as function through the aspects that are affecting your psychological wellness or may be activating your mental health and wellness condition. The objective of psychotherapy is to get rid of or manage disabling or troubling thought as well as behavior patterns so you can operate better.

After finishing residency, a lot of psychiatrists take a volunteer composed and also dental exam offered by the American Board of Psychiatry and also Neurology to end up being a board-certified psychoanalyst. Some psychiatrists also complete fellowship programs to specialize in a certain location of psychiatry, such as youngster and also teenage psychiatry, which concentrates on the psychological wellness in the pediatric populace, or appointment intermediary psychiatry, which studies the interface of physical and also mental health and wellness in the clinical population.

Psychiatry is the branch of medication that concentrates on the prevention, diagnosis, and treatment of psychological, behavior, and also emotional conditions. Psychiatrists get clinical training that allows them recommend medications and carry out procedures.


Psycho therapists mainly offer counseling as well as nonmedical support yet do neuro-psych assessments. Psycho therapists have a postgraduate degree (Ph, D). They utilize talk therapy to assist individuals however can not suggest medication. A therapist is a mental health expert who has a master's level. Their research studies may be in psychology, family members therapy, or therapy.


And while a psychiatrist can suggest medication, a specialist can not. When you make a visit with a psychiatrist, they'll first ask concerning your psychological as well as physical symptoms.
